Abstract

We have developed a model for friction in a dry granular material,that allows multiple reversible transitions between stick and slipcontacts. The ultimate purpose of the model is to simulatedeposition processes. During these processes a pile structure isformed that is repeatedly destabilised by addition of new material.The present model does not yet include rotation. The model is testedfor a few simple systems. Finally we perform more extensive granulardynamics simulations using the model for 2D and 3D systems. In eachsystem, a steady flow of material is dropped onto a rough surface.DOI : http://dx.doi.org/10.22342/jims.13.2.83.173-189

Abstract

In this paper, it is proved that the supremum of a family of fuzzy number scan be finitely approximated via Lp metrics and the concrete approaches are given. As a byproduct, it is proved that the L1 metric d1 defined via cut-set is equivalent to ametric which can be calculated directly via membership functions. Since the Lp metrics are analytic in nature, the results in this paper may have interesting applications infuzzy analysis. For example, it may provide a method for the computation of various fuzzy-number-valued integrals.DOI : http://dx.doi.org/10.22342/jims.13.2.88.197-208

Abstract

We consider two-dimensional cutting stock problems where single rectangular stocks have to be cut into some smaller rectangular so that the number of stocks needed to satisfy the demands is minimum. In this paper we focus our study to the problem where the stocks have to be cut with guillotine cutting type and fixed orientation of finals. We formulate the problem as an integer programming, where the relaxation problem is solved by column generation technique. New pattern generation is formulated based on method of stripe. In obtaining the integer solution, we round down the optimal solution of the relaxation problem and then we derive an extra mix integer programming for satisfying the unmet demands. The optimal solution of the original problem is the combination of the round-down solution and the optimal solution of the extra mix integer programming.A numerical example of the problem is given in the end of this paper.DOI : http://dx.doi.org/10.22342/jims.13.2.65.161-172
